Output 7ee636f96ffe492ad63eb7af39aec2c4702cf5f9da2521707c8589418d31a54a:19

value
22001332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 942111828634f1c6d37ca93499eeaf8e87c8eb2d OP_EQUAL
address
MMQPrTGMMm1f7FWinvX8QF7FaiCX3RcEiy
transaction
7ee636f96ffe492ad63eb7af39aec2c4702cf5f9da2521707c8589418d31a54a
spent
true